OTF - Blue Owl Technology Finance Corp.


11.94
0.020   0.168%

Share volume: 1,929,902
Last Updated: 03-05-2026

PREVIOUS CLOSE
CHG
CHG%

$11.92
0.02
0.00%
5D - 1M - 3M - 1Y - 3Y - 5Y - 10Y - 15Y
EX Date 06-30-2025 09-22-2025 09-30-2025 12-23-2025 12-31-2025
Payment Date
Record Date
Declared Date
Amount 0.35 0.05 0.35 0.05 0.35
Flag
Currency USD USD USD USD USD
Description
Frequency